Analysis
In 2023, general government total expenditure (current lcu), per square in Senegal stood at 34.33 million current LCU per square kilometre. That is the highest value across all 44 years on record.
The figure is up 5.7% on the previous year and up 220.2% over ten years.
Over the whole period, general government total expenditure (current lcu), per square in Senegal peaked at 34.33 million current LCU per square kilometre in 2023 and was at its lowest, 0 current LCU per square kilometre, in 1980.
Senegal ranks 38th of 195 countries on this measure, in the top quarter.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

How this figure is calculated
General government total expenditure (current LCU) divided by Land area (sq. km), matched on country and year. Neither publisher issues this ratio as a series; it is computed here from both.
General government total expenditure (current LCU) ÷ Land area (sq. km)
Computed from
- General government total expenditure UNESCO Institute for Statistics
- Land area FAOSTAT,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ations (FAO)
Statizoid computes this series; the underlying measurements belong to the publishers named above. The arithmetic is applied to every country and year where both inputs report, and nothing is estimated unless the page says so.
